Output 93e0784ad867f338df05f21fc2673a33ecc136bdb4b005e4a4f827e4bd0537d3:2

value
299867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70e43d3926922d75d37c9eeeb2f4197204263853 OP_EQUAL
address
3Byw2N1t4qkPm4PevKp6jEE8HKVMJuy392
transaction
93e0784ad867f338df05f21fc2673a33ecc136bdb4b005e4a4f827e4bd0537d3
spent
true